Flynn Knight is the only (and frankly, impossible) child of the leader of the vampires in Los Angeles. He's also a bit of a scatterbrain, a thirty-something manchild, and a private investigator. When one of his mother's political frenemies gets killed and she asks him to investigate, he's put between a rock—her—and a hard place—the fact that not a single vampire in the city will believe the answers he finds without impressive proof to back him up.

Combine that with an eighty-thousand-dollar bill he has no idea how he's going to pay, a hit and run that has landed him a victim of the cat distribution system, and his mother trying to foist a new business partner off on him, and his life is way more complicated than he likes.

At least his new partner is nice to look at, even if he's the weirdest vampire ever, who doesn't seem to follow any of the usual vampire rules.

Also, why won't this kitten stop eating?

Smokescreen is set in the Fantastic Fluke universe, starring never before seen characters and a new setting. It begins to explore Flynn Knight’s relationships, and while it contains a complete story, it does not reach the slow burn romance plot, and the main overarching plot will continue in book two, Façade.

Smokescreen opens Knight & Daywalker with sharp supernatural intrigue, dry humor, and a case that immediately entangles personal history with professional danger. Burns excels at slow, deliberate relationship building, letting trust form through shared investigation rather than forced proximity or easy chemistry. The mystery unfolds with steady pressure, balancing action and deduction while revealing a world that feels lived-in without drowning the reader in lore. The emotional core is quiet but deliberate, grounded in restraint, longing, and the tension of two people circling what they can’t yet claim. It’s a confident, character-driven start that promises a series built on patience, payoff, and smart supernatural stakes.
